Запустите Desktop PWA в полноэкранном режиме или в режиме киоска - PullRequest
0 голосов
/ 03 октября 2019

Я искал решение, но не нашел ничего, что работает. Я пытаюсь запустить PWA с настольного компьютера Windows, добавленного с Chrome, в режиме киоска или, по крайней мере, в полноэкранном режиме (без строк меню вообще). Я думаю, что это будет очень распространено, но я не нашел ничего, что работает. Я добавил display: fullscreen в manifest.json, но, похоже, это не работает для рабочего стола.

Я в порядке с любым видом Javascript, но я бы не хотел, чтобы какое-либо взаимодействие с пользователем нажималоF11 или что-нибудь. Он предназначен для автономного телевизионного дисплея.

Фактический результат после запуска

Желаемый результат после запуска

{
  "name": "vuejs-display-new",
  "short_name": "vuejs-display-new",
  "icons": [
    {
      "src": "./img/icons/android-chrome-192x192.png",
      "sizes": "192x192",
      "type": "image/png"
    },
    {
      "src": "./img/icons/android-chrome-512x512.png",
      "sizes": "512x512",
      "type": "image/png"
    }
  ],
  "start_url": "./side/adds",
  "display": "fullscreen",
  "orientation": "landscape",
  "background_color": "#000000",
  "theme_color": "#4DBA87"
}

Ответы [ 3 ]

0 голосов
/ 28 октября 2019

Я тоже ищу решение для этого. Я обновился до Windows 10 Pro и пытаюсь использовать режим Windows Kiosk, но приложение не отображается в меню приложений, которые вы можете установить в качестве своего киоска.

Одна вещь, которую нужно уточнитьЯ думаю, что после OP тоже было то, что простой полноэкранный режим не работает для общедоступных киосков, поскольку существует много способов непреднамеренного запуска окна, чтобы свести к минимуму (даже на сенсорном экране), например, если провести пальцем по левому нижнему углу, откроются окна. icon.

Я только начал искать, поэтому я сообщу здесь, если / когда узнаю, как заставить мое приложение отображаться в меню киоска Win 10 Pro!

0 голосов
/ 30 октября 2019

После установки PWA вы должны перейти к свойствам ярлыка и в конце поля добавить код в конце:

--fullscreen --kiosk

Полностью закройте Chrome и откройте ярлык pwa

0 голосов
/ 09 октября 2019

Кажется, что свойство display:"fullscreen" работает правильно, так как вы не видите ни адресной строки браузера, ни других элементов пользовательского интерфейса.

Однако некоторые свойства CSS могут устанавливать содержимое вне области просмотра. Я бы дважды проверил, что свойство макета не мешает содержанию страницы.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...